D.To get a ticket. 【答案】11.B 12.C 13.B 14.D 15.A 【难度】0.65 【知识点】时文/广告/布告、应用文 【导语】本文是一篇应用文。文章主要介绍了即将在本市举办的国际文化交流节,包括活动时间、地点、内容、报名方式及注意事项,邀请市民参与体验多元文化。 11.细节理解题。根据“Date: August 1st—August 14th”可知,国际文化交流节从8月1日到14日,共14天,即两周。故选B。 12.细节理解题。根据“Place: City International Cultural Center”可知,国际文化交流节将在城市国际文化中心举行。故选C。 13.细节理解题。根据“Activities | Cultural Performances: Watch traditional dances, music performances”可知,在国际文化交流节期间,人们可以观看传统舞蹈。故选B。 14.细节理解题。根据“How to Sign Up | Visit the official website...fill out the online form”可知,人们可以通过其官网报名参加国际文化交流节。故选D。 15.细节理解题。根据“Important Notes | Please arrive at least 15 minutes before any activity begins so you can get in without any problems.”可知,提前15分钟到达,这样就能顺利入场而不会遇到任何麻烦。故选A。 B ①On Earth, we use bricks (砖块) to build houses, but what about building things on the moon? ▲ Scientists at Huazhong University of Science and Technology (HUST) have developed “lunar bricks”. They hope to use the bricks to build a research station on the moon. ②To make the bricks, the scientists used a lunar soil simulant (模拟月壤). The bricks are more than three times stronger than normal red bricks. They also have special structures, which were used in ancient Chinese buildings. This makes it possible to simply put these bricks together. ③Professor Zhou Cheng from HUST said that they had tested five different kinds of simulated lunar soil compositions (成分) and used three ways to harden them. In this way they could choose the best materials for making the bricks. “Lunar soil isn’t the same everywhere on the moon,” Zhou said, “For example, one of the kinds tested simulates the lunar soil at the landing site of ‘Chang’e 5’, which is mainly basalt (玄武岩).” ④The lunar bricks need to be tested well before being used because the moon has an extreme (极端的) environment. Quakes often happen there. And it gets as hot as 180℃ during the day and as cold as -190℃ at night. The lunar bricks have been sent to China’s space station on the “Tianzhou 8” spacecraft. There, scientists will carry out tests to see how well the bricks work in space. The first brick is expected to return to Earth by the end of 2025. 16.Which of the following can be put in “ ▲ ” in Paragraph 1? A.We use “lunar bricks”, of course! In this way they could choose the best materials for making the bricks.”可知,科学家们通过做多次的测试和用不同的方法处理月球土壤来找到适合制作月球砖的材料。故选D。 19.主旨大意题。根据“The lunar bricks need to be tested well before being used because the moon has an extreme (极端的) environment.”及通读第四段可知,第四段主要说明月球环境极端,需要在空间站进一步测试月球砖的原因。故选B。 20.篇章结构题。通读全文可知,①②段介绍月球砖的提出与特点;③段讲如何挑选制砖材料;④段说明需在太空测试及未来计划。故选B。 C Why are DJI drones so successful? Da Jiang Innovations, known as DJI, is a leader in drone technology. Wang Tao started working on DJI’s projects during his college years in Hong Kong. In 2006, he moved to Shenzhen and created a small team. That same year, he set up DJI. At first, DJI focused on developing flight control systems. Then they created the multi-rotor autopilot system (多旋翼自驾系统), which made drones more stable (稳定的) during flight. This was a big step forward in drone technology and led to DJI’s first consumer drone (消费级无人机) in 2013: the Phantom 1, which was more user-friendly than other drones available at the time. The Phantom 1 was a game-changer. It made aerial photography (航拍) easy for everyone, not just experts. With remote control and GPS systems, users could take amazing sky-high videos and photos. Besides, DJI has also developed drones for different needs. For example, the Inspire series is widely used in filmmaking, while the Matrice series helps with important tasks like fighting fires or finding lost people. More and more people are using the Pocket series to record their daily lives. As a drone technology pioneer, DJI continues to improve. It is the first company to offer 4K video recording in consumer drones. DJI drones are also built with safety in mind. They use GPS systems to find and then stay away from things in the way, which helps prevent accidents. Today, DJI drones are a symbol of Chinese innovation (创新), showing the country’s growing influence in high-tech fields. 21.What direct effect does the multi-rotor autopilot system have?
